Web6. jan 2024 · Many people with bloating symptoms don't have any more gas in the intestine than do other people. Many people, particularly those with irritable bowel syndrome or anxiety, may have a greater sensitivity to abdominal symptoms and intestinal gas, rather than an excess amount. Web3. mar 2024 · Burps that escape through the nose are almost completely silent. This is because they don't vibrate the upper esophageal sphincter, like a mouth burp. The sound produced will be like that of a normal exhalation through the nose, though any odor may remain. Try to have clear sinuses beforehand - otherwise, your burp will have nowhere to go. Web26. jan 2024 · This means that people who have the condition are often unable to burp. The sphincter is a muscular valve that sits just below when the Adam's apple is. Each time we eat, drink or swallow, the sphincter relaxes for a second - the rest of the time it is contracted.
